You too can get an extremely limited set! All you have to do is manage to get in on one of the Lego Inside Tours in Billund. They're 2.5 days long, happen three times in May and June, and have room for 22 people apiece. At least, this is how the 2012 tours are set up.
And they cost $2000. They include 2 nights hotel and most of your meals and all of your tour transportation, and a tour-exclusive set.
I probably wouldn't go over there exclusively for the tour, but if I were going to Europe for another reason, I'd try and make the it happen.

CharlesWillisMaddox posted:

When you say "so expensive" how expensive are we talking?

About $2-7, depending on condition. The gold printing on their torsos is commonly faded away and the chin pieces of their helmets were easy to break.
